Design and Build Quality of the Tissot Solar Connected Watch

The Tissot T-Touch Connect Solar boasts a robust yet stylish design. Its case measures 47.5 mm in diameter. This size suits those who prefer larger watches. However, it may feel bulky on smaller wrists. The thickness is 15.3 mm, which adds to its presence. Made from hypoallergenic titanium, the case feels light and durable. Moreover, it resists scratches well.

The bezel uses scratch-resistant ceramic. This material enhances longevity. Luminescent markers on the bezel aid visibility in low light. The sapphire crystal covers the dial. It has an antireflective coating for clear viewing. This crystal is also tactile, allowing touch inputs. Water resistance reaches 100 meters. Thus, it handles swimming and daily wear easily.

Straps come in various options, like rubber or titanium bracelets. They feature quick-release systems for easy swaps. The overall aesthetic mixes sporty and elegant vibes. For instance, models with rose-gold PVD coating add a luxury touch. At AI Luxury Boutique, we appreciate how this watch fits both casual and formal settings. Nevertheless, its size might not appeal to everyone.

Key Features and Functionality

This section dives into what makes the Tissot T-Touch Connect Solar unique. It runs on the Sw-ALPS operating system. This low-energy platform ensures efficiency. The watch connects via Bluetooth to smartphones. It works with iOS, Android, and Harmony OS. As a result, users get notifications for calls, texts, and apps.

The tactile sapphire allows direct interaction. Users tap or swipe to access functions. For example, the electronic crown helps navigate menus. Basic features include time display in multiple zones. It also has automatic daylight saving adjustments. A perpetual calendar keeps dates accurate forever.

Outdoor enthusiasts will love the sensors. The altimeter tracks elevation changes. The barometer predicts weather trends. A compass provides direction. Additionally, a thermometer measures temperature. These tools make it ideal for hiking or adventures.

Activity tracking is another highlight. It counts steps and calories burned. It also logs distance traveled. The watch includes a chrono function for timing events. Options like split and lap timing add versatility. A timer and alarm keep users on schedule.

In connected mode, it shows incoming calls and alerts. Users can lock the screen for security. An eco mode saves power when needed. The app, called T-Connect, manages settings. It syncs data and updates firmware. However, some users report app glitches. Still, updates have improved it over time.

Performance in Daily Use

How does the Tissot T-Touch Connect Solar perform day to day? First, its hybrid nature shines. It looks like a classic watch but adds smart perks. The MIP digital screen is highly legible. It shows info without draining power fast. In sunlight, the display remains clear.

Connectivity is reliable once set up. Pairing with the app takes a few minutes. After that, notifications arrive promptly. However, some reviews note delays in syncing. Patience is key during initial use. The tactile interface responds well to touches. Swipes feel intuitive after practice.

For fitness, tracking is accurate for basics. Steps and distance match other devices closely. Calories burned estimates are helpful. But it lacks heart rate monitoring in the base model. The Sport version adds this later. Outdoor functions like the altimeter work great on hikes. The compass calibrates easily.

Durability stands out. The titanium case withstands bumps. Ceramic bezel stays pristine. Water resistance holds up in showers or pools. Overall, it feels built to last. At AI Luxury Boutique, we value such quality in luxury items.

Battery Life and Solar Charging

One standout aspect is the solar charging. Photovoltaic cells under the dial capture light. This recharges the quartz movement. In full use, battery lasts up to six months. Without connection, it extends further. Eco mode boosts this even more.

Exposure to light keeps it powered. Indoor lights work, but sunlight is best. A new feature shows solar energy levels. This helps users charge efficiently. No need for frequent plugs like traditional smartwatches. This autonomy sets it apart. However, in dark conditions, power drops faster. Still, it’s a game-changer for long-term wear.

App Experience and Connectivity

The T-Connect app is central to the experience. It handles data sync and customizations. Users view activity logs and set alarms. Firmware updates come through here. The interface is straightforward. Yet, early versions had bugs. Recent improvements fix many issues.

Compatibility is broad. It pairs with most phones. Notifications cover emails and social apps. But features are basic compared to Apple Watch. No voice assistants or apps install. Instead, it excels in privacy. Data stays local, not in clouds. This appeals to security-conscious users.
